Shifting Conceptions of Violence and Power in Philosophy
This chapter examines how perceptions of violence have changed over time, influenced by technological advancements such as the atomic bomb. It also explores the theological implications of power in Christianity and the significance of non-use of power in the writings of prominent thinkers.
